Japan Alkaline Hydrolysis Systems Market Regulatory and Policy Environment

Japan’s regulatory framework significantly influences market development, with policies emphasizing waste reduction, recycling, and environmental safety. The Waste Management and Public Cleansing Law, coupled with specific regulations on biological and hazardous waste disposal, mandates the adoption of environmentally sound treatment technologies like alkaline hydrolysis. Recent amendments incentivize the deployment of green technologies through subsidies and tax benefits.

Government agencies actively promote innovation via grants and pilot programs, fostering a conducive environment for market expansion. Additionally, Japan’s commitment to international environmental agreements enhances the regulatory push for sustainable waste management solutions. Compliance with strict emission standards and safety protocols remains paramount, prompting continuous technological upgrades. The evolving policy landscape underscores the importance of aligning product development with regulatory requirements to ensure market access and competitive advantage.
